GW's decided to revamp their Circuit Points system:
+++
Clearly Set Tournament Circuit Points Values
There was a bit of confusion about how many points could be earned at
each event. This year it is very clear. The Games Day Tournaments have
a reduced Tournament Circuit Points value as they are typically
smaller events (fewer games and a smaller field) with the added
distractions of Games Day itself. We will see how this system goes for
2008.
No Bonus Points for Other Awards
We had one or two situations last year where players won 3rd Overall
and (by the GW system of "more awards to more people") were therefore
ineligible to win the Best Painted (or Best Sportsman) prize that then
went to the player that had won 4th place. Because of the Bonus
Points, the 4th placed player received more Tournament Circuit Points
than the 3rd placed player. We thought that was pretty strange and so
this year we are not awarding any bonus Circuit points for Best
Painted, Best General, Best Sportsman and the like. Please note, these
types of awards will still be presented at events, they just won't
earn bonus Tournament Circuit Points. The fact that most the
independently run tournaments have all manner of their own special
awards only adds to the confusion, so we definitely think removing
them from the Circuit scoring system is the right thing to do.
At the end of the event, players will receive Tournament Circuit
Points based on how they finished overall at the event. There are two
standard sets of points that are available at the events on the
Circuit for 2008. They are as follows:
Tournament A Point Scale
Place Points
1st 300
2nd 280
3rd 270
4th 260
5th 250
6th 240
7th 230
8th 220
9th 210
10th 200
11-20 150
21-50 100
51st+ 50
Tournament B Point Scale
Place Points
1st 200
2nd 190
3rd 180
4th 170
5th 160
6th 150
7th 140
8th 130
9th 120
10th 110
11-20 100
21st+ 50
Points Cap
This is primarily a response to requests from dozens of last year's
participants, including many of those who attended all of the events
on the Circuit. We agree that players shouldn't have to attend upwards
of a dozen events to have a chance at winning the Tournament Circuit.
As a result, we have decided to only count the top THREE Circuit
scores for each player when calculating the final Circuit standings.
This way more hobbyists will have a chance at reaching the top
grouping and we suspect the players who jet around to lots of
tournaments will still perform very well. This will also mean that
more of your precious hobby dollars can be spent supporting your local
hobby store rather than being handed over to hotel chains and
airlines!
